Lentiviral vector-mediated expression of MYO7A. (a–c) Immunofluorescence shows MYO7A immunolabel in (a) Myo7a+/− RPE, (b) Myo7a−/− RPE, 7 days after infection with LV-MYO7A(B), and (c) Myo7a−/− RPE, 7 days after infection with LV-MYO7A(A). (d) A phase contrast image of (c). (e) Western blot of MYO7A protein (upper panel) in Myo7a+/− RPE (Ctrl), Myo7a−/− RPE (Mut) and Myo7a−/− RPE, 5 days after infection with LV-MYO7A(B) (Mut+B). HSP60 labeling (lower panel) was used as a loading control. (f) Alkaline phosphatase (AP) histochemistry of a retinal section from an albino control mice. The retina was injected at P4 with LV-AP(B) and fixed at P14. Arrows and arrowheads indicate AP staining in the RPE and photoreceptor cells, respectively. Area shown is away from the site of injection. (g, h) MYO7A immunostaining (arrows) of the RPE in the central (g) and peripheral (h) regions of the retina from an albino Myo7a−/− mouse. The retina was injected centrally at P96 with the LV-MYO7A(B) virus and fixed 6 days later. Faint, non-specific staining9 is evident in the photoreceptor synaptic layer. RPE, retinal pigment epithelium; ONL, outer nuclear layer. Scale bars = 20 μm (a–d), 50 μm (f–h).
